Crimea to hold referendum on Ukraine’s accession into NATO

All-Crimean popular meeting has determined the date of Crimean national referendum on Ukraine’s accession into NATO. The event will take place on December 16.

More than a thousand of representatives of various regions of the autonomy took part in the meeting. They have formed All-Crimean public council on constitutional rights of Crimea and delegated authorities of an election commission to it.

The participants of the meeting have created 25 election districts and approved the content of the bulletin.

The bulletin contains only one question: “Do you agree with the policy of President Victor Yushchenko as regards Ukraine’s accession into NATO.”
